Output e68fc59e15810c181af11ce8d33074e7ed3633a304454ea026927bc94e5407b1:133

value
37762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cc9d7d5e22678ff20403f79a928f0dc9c8a1066 OP_EQUAL
address
3MpSP3wBsvSXemRw7wAYji6JeaR28ZZUAF
transaction
e68fc59e15810c181af11ce8d33074e7ed3633a304454ea026927bc94e5407b1